40. Client
Munich Tourism
The Project
Munich Tourism wanted to create an online program that trained travel agents in
India to know about Munich in detail and what it offers to tourists. This would
enable them to engage better with Indian tourists and sell the destination
effectively.
41. We engaged with their Indian Marketing Agents, Buzz Travel
Marketing, to understand the behaviour and profile of Indian
Travel Agents and provided the Tourism Department an end-to-
end solution.
We created and designed the webinterface, the content and a
Wordpress-based Learning Management System for them.
The online program is online on www.munichtravelguru.com
45. Client
NIIT Limited
NIIT Limited offers learning solutions to corporations, institutions and individuals.
It has three main lines of business worldwide: Corporate Learning Group (CLG),
Skills and Careers Group (SNC), and School Learning Group (SLG).
The Project
This project for the School Learning Group (SLG). They wanted to create a short
animated AV to explain the concept of MathLab. The AV had to incorporate the
findings of a study that Deloitte had conducted for NIIT.
The AV is being used by both training and business development teams.
